To find the number of bugs after 8 days using the equation \( A(t) = 6 \cdot 2^{0.25t} \), we substitute \( t = 8 \):
\[ A(8) = 6 \cdot 2^{0.25 \cdot 8} \]
First, we calculate \( 0.25 \cdot 8 \):
\[ 0.25 \cdot 8 = 2 \]
Now we substitute this back into the equation:
\[ A(8) = 6 \cdot 2^2 \]
Next, we calculate \( 2^2 \):
\[ 2^2 = 4 \]
Now, substituting \( 4 \) back into the equation gives:
\[ A(8) = 6 \cdot 4 = 24 \]
Therefore, the number of bugs after 8 days is \( \boxed{24} \).
